Origin of Greek philosophy.

In Chapter II. I have described the origin and decline of Greek Mythology; in this, I am to relate the first European attempt at philosophizing. The Ionian systems spring directly out of the contemporary religious opinions, and appear as a phase in Greek comparative theology.

Contrasted with the psychical condition of India, we cannot but be struck with the feebleness of these first European efforts. They correspond to that period in which the mind has shaken off its ideas of sorcery, but has not advanced beyond geocentral and anthropocentral conceptions. As is uniformly observed, as soon as man has Its imperfections. collected what he considers to be trustworthy data, he forthwith applies them to a cosmogony, and develops pseudo-scientific systems. It is not until a later period that he awakens to the suspicion that we have no absolute knowledge of truth.

The reader, who might, perhaps, be repelled by the apparent worthlessness of the succession of Greek opinions now to be described, will find them assume an interest, if considered in the aggregate, or viewed as a series of steps or stages of European approach to conclusions long before arrived at in Egypt and India. Far in advance of anything that Greece can offer, the intellectual history of India furnishes systems at once consistent and imposing—systems not remaining useless speculations, but becoming inwoven in social life.

Commences in Asia Minor.

Greek philosophy is considered as having originated with Thales, who, though of Phoenician descent, was born at Miletus, a Greek colony in Asia Minor, about B.C. 640. At that time, as related in the last chapter, the Egyptian ports had been opened to foreigners by Psammetichus. In the civil war which that monarch had been waging with his colleagues, he owed his success to Ionian and other Greek mercenaries whom he had employed; but, though proving victor in the contest, his political position was such as to compel him to depart from the maxims followed in his country for so many thousand years, and to permit foreigners to have access to it. Hitherto the Europeans had been only known to the Egyptians as pirates and cannibals.

Doctrine of Thales
is derived from Egypt.

From the doctrine of Thales, it may be inferred that, though he had visited Egypt, he had never been in communication with its sources of learning, but had merely mingled among the vulgar, from whom he had gathered the popular notion that the first principle is water. The state of things in Egypt suggests that this primitive dogma of European philosophy was a popular notion in that country. With but little care on the part of men the fertilizing Nile-water yielded those abundant crops which made Egypt the granary of the Old World. It might therefore be said, both philosophically and facetiously, that the first principle Importance of water in Egypt. of all things is water. The harvests depended on it, and, through them, animals and man. The government of the country was supported by it, for the financial system was founded on a tax paid by the proprietors of the land for the use of the public sluices and aqueducts. There was not a peasant to whom it was not apparent that water is the first principle of all things, even of taxation; and, since it was not only necessary to survey lands to ascertain the surface that had been irrigated, but to redetermine their boundaries after the subsidence of the flood, even the scribes and surveyors might concede that geometry itself was indebted for its origin to water.

Thales asserts that water is the first principle.

If, therefore, in any part of the Old World, this doctrine had both a vulgar and a philosophical significance, that country was Egypt. We may picture to ourselves the inquisitive but ill-instructed Thales carried in some pirate-ship or trading-bark to the mysterious Nile, respecting which Ionia was full of legends and myths. He saw the aqueducts, canals, flood-gates, the great Lake Moeris, dug by the hand of man as many ages before his day as have elapsed from his day to ours; he saw on all sides the adoration paid to the river, for it had actually become deified; he learned from the vulgar, with whom alone he came in contact, their universal belief that all things arise from water—from the vulgar alone, for, had he ever been taught by the priests, we should have found traces in his system of the doctrines of emanation, transmigration, and absorption, which were imported into Greece in later times. We may interpret the story of Thales on the principles which would apply in the case of some intelligent Indian who should find his way to the outposts of a civilized country. Imperfectly acquainted with the language, and coming in contact with the lower class alone, he might learn their vulgar philosophy, and carry back the fancied treasure to his home.

As to the profound meaning which some have been disposed to extract from the dogma of Thales, we shall, perhaps, be warranted in rejecting it altogether. It has been affirmed that he attempted to concentrate all supernatural powers in one; to reduce all possible agents to unity; in short, out of polytheism to bring forth monotheism; to determine the invariable in the variable; and to ascertain the beginning of things: that he observed how infinite is the sea; how necessary moisture is to growth; nay, even how essential it was to the well-being of himself; "that without moisture his own body would not have been what it was, but a dry husk falling to pieces." Nor can we adopt the opinion that the intention of Thales was to establish a coincidence between philosophy and the popular theology as delivered by Hesiod, who affirms that Oceanus is one of the parent-gods of Nature. The imputation of irreligion made against him shows at what an early period the antagonism of polytheism and scientific inquiry was recognized. But it is possible to believe that all things are formed out of one primordial substance, without denying the existence of a creative power. Or, to use the Indian illustration, the clay may not be the potter.

Other doctrines of Thales.

Thales is said to have predicted the solar eclipse which terminated a battle between the Medes and Lydians, but it has been suggestively remarked that it is not stated that he predicted the day on which it should occur. He had an idea that warmth originates from or is nourished by humidity, and that even the sun and stars derived their aliment out of the sea at the time of their rising and setting. Indeed, he regarded them as living beings; obtaining an argument from the phenomena of amber and the magnet, supposed by him to possess a living soul, because they have a moving force. Moreover, he taught that the whole world is an insouled thing, and that it is full of dÆmons. Thales had, therefore, not completely passed out of the stage of sorcery.

His system obtained importance not only from its own plausibility, but because it was introduced under favourable auspices and at a favourable time. It came into Asia Minor as a portion of the wisdom of Egypt, and therefore with a prestige sufficient to assure for it an attentive reception. But this would have been of little avail had not the mental culture of Ionia been advanced to a degree suitable for offering to it conditions of development. Under such circumstances the Egyptian dogma formed the starting-point for a special method of philosophizing.

They constitute the starting-point of Ionian philosophy.

The manner in which that development took place illustrates the vigour of the Grecian mind. In Egypt a doctrine might exist for thousands of years, protected by its mere antiquity from controversy or even examination, and hence sink with the lapse of time into an ineffectual and lifeless state; but the same doctrine brought into a young community full of activity would quickly be made productive and yield new results. As seeds taken from the coffins of mummies, wherein they have been shut up for thousands of years, when placed under circumstances favourable for development in a rich soil, and supplied with moisture, have forthwith, even in our own times, germinated, borne flowers, and matured new seeds, so the rude philosophy of Thales passed through a like development. Its tendency is shown in the attempt it at once made to describe the universe, even before the parts thereof had been determined.

Anaximenes asserts that air is the first principle.

But it is not alone the water or ocean that seems to be infinite, and capable of furnishing a supply for the origin of all other things. The air, also, appears to reach as far as the stars. On it, as Anaximenes of Miletus remarks, "the very earth itself floats like a broad leaf." Accordingly, this Ionian, stimulated doubtless by the hope of sharing in or succeeding to the celebrity that Thales had enjoyed for a century, proposed to substitute for water, as the primitive source of things, atmospheric air. And, in truth, there seem to be reasons for bestowing upon it such a pre-eminence. To those who have not looked closely into the matter, it would appear that water itself is generated from it, as when clouds are formed, and from them rain-drops, and springs, and fountains, and rivers, and even the sea. He also attributes infinity to it, a dogma scarcely requiring any exercise of the imagination, but being rather the expression of an ostensible fact; for who, when he looks upward, can discern the boundary of the atmosphere. It is also the soul. Anaximenes also held that even the human soul itself is nothing but air, since life consists in inhaling and exhaling it, and ceases as soon as that process stops. He taught also that warmth and cold arise from mere rarefaction and condensation, and gave as a proof the fact that when we breathe with the lips drawn together the air is cold, but it becomes warm when we breathe through the widely-opened mouth. Hence he concluded that, with a sufficient rarefaction, air might turn into fire, and that this probably was the origin of the sun and stars, blazing comets, and other meteors; but if by chance it should undergo condensation, it would turn into wind and clouds, or, if that operation should be still more increased, into water, snow, hail, and, at last, even into earth itself. And since it is seen from the results of The air is God. breathing that the air is a life-giving principle to man, nay, even is actually his soul, it would appear to be a just inference that the infinite air is God and that the gods and goddesses have sprung from it.

Such was the philosophy of Anaximenes. It was the beginning of that stimulation of activity by rival schools which played so distinguished a part in the Greek intellectual movement. Its superiority over the doctrine of Thales evidently consists in this, that it not only assigns a primitive substance, but even undertakes to show by observation and experiment how others arise from it, and transformations occur. As to the discovery of the obliquity of the ecliptic by the aid of a gnomon attributed to Anaximenes, it was merely a boast of his vainglorious countrymen, and altogether beyond the scientific grasp of one who had no more exact idea of the nature of the earth than that it was "like a broad leaf floating in the air."

Diogenes asserts that air is the soul of the world.

The doctrines of Anaximenes received a very important development in the hands of Diogenes of Apollonia, who asserted that all things originate from one essence, which, undergoing continual changes, becoming different at different times, turns back again to the same state. He regarded the entire world as a living being, spontaneously evolving and transforming itself, and agreed with Anaximenes that the soul of man is nothing but air, as is also the soul of the world. From this it follows that the air must be eternal, imperishable, and endowed with consciousness. "It knows much; for without reason it would be impossible for all to be arranged so duly and proportionately as that all should maintain its fitting measure, winter and summer, night and day, the rain, the wind, and fair weather; and whatever object we consider will be found to have been ordered in the best and most beautiful manner possible." "But that which has knowledge is that which men call air; it is it that regulates and governs all, and hence it is the use of air to pervade all, and to dispose all, and to be in all, for there is nothing that has not part in it."

Difficulty of rising above fetichism.

The early cultivator of philosophy emerges with difficulty from fetichism. The harmony observed among the parts of the world is easily explained on the hypothesis of a spiritual principle residing in things, and arranging them by its intelligent volition. It is not at once that he rises to the conception that all this beauty and harmony are due to the operation of law. We are so prone to judge of the process of external things from the modes of our own personal experience, our acts being determined by the exercise of our wills, that it is with difficulty we disentangle ourselves from such notions in the explanation of natural phenomena. Fetichism may be observed in the infancy of many of the natural sciences. Thus the electrical power of amber was imputed to a soul residing in that substance, a similar explanation being also given of the control of the magnet over iron. The movements of the planetary bodies, Mercury, Venus, Mars, were attributed to an intelligent principle residing in each, Astronomy and chemistry have passed beyond the fetich stage. guiding and controlling the motions, and ordering all things for the best. It was an epoch in the history of the human mind when astronomy set an example to all other sciences of shaking off its fetichism, and showing that the intricate movements of the heavenly bodies are all capable not only of being explained, but even foretold, if once was admitted the existence of a simple, yet universal, invariable, and eternal law.

Not without difficulty do men perceive that there is nothing inconsistent between invariable law and endlessly varying phenomena, and that it is a more noble view of the government of this world to impute its order to a penetrating primitive wisdom, which could foresee consequences throughout a future eternity, and provide for them in the original plan at the outset, than to invoke the perpetual intervention of an ever-acting spiritual agency for the purpose of warding off misfortunes that might happen, and setting things to rights. Chemistry furnishes us with a striking example—an example very opportune in the case we are considering—of the doctrine of Diogenes of Apollonia, that the air is actually a spiritual being; for, on the discovery of several of the gases by the earlier experimenters, they were not only regarded as of a spiritual nature, but actually received the name under which they pass to this day, gheist or gas, from a belief that they were ghosts. If a labourer descended into a well and was suffocated, as if struck dead by some invisible hand; if a lamp lowered down burnt for a few moments with a lurid flame, and was then extinguished; if, in a coal mine, when the unwary workman exposed a light, on a sudden the place was filled with flashing flames and thundering explosions, tearing down the rocks and destroying every living thing in the way, often, too, without leaving on the dead any marks of violence; what better explanation could be given of such catastrophes than to impute them to some supernatural agent? Nor was there any want, in those times, of well-authenticated stories of unearthly faces and forms seen in such solitudes.

Origin of psychology.

The modification made by Diogenes in the theory of Anaximenes, by converting it from a physical into a psychological system, is important, as marking the beginning of the special philosophy of Greece. The investigation of the intellectual development of the universe led the Greeks to the study of the intellect itself. In his special doctrine, Diogenes imputed the changeability of the air to its mobility; a property in which he thought it excelled all other substances, because it is among the rarest or thinnest of the elements. It is, however, said by some, who are disposed to transcendentalize his doctrine, that he did not mean the common atmospheric air, but something more attenuated and warm; and since, in its purest state, it constitutes the most perfect intellect, inferior degrees of reason must be owing to an increase of its density and moisture. Upon such a principle, the whole earth is animated by the breath of life; the souls of brutes, which differ from one another so much in intelligence, are only air in its various conditions of moisture and warmth. He explained the production of the world through condensation of the earth from air by cold, the warmth rising upward and forming the sun; in the stars he thought he recognized the respiratory organs of the world. From the preponderance of moist air in the constitution of brutes, he inferred that they are like the insane, incapable of thought, for thickness of the air impedes respiration, and therefore quick apprehension. From the fact that plants have no cavities wherein to receive the air, and are altogether unintelligent, he was led to the principle that the thinking power of man arises from the flowing of that substance throughout the body in the blood. He also explained the superior intelligence of men from their breathing a purer air than the beasts, which carry their nostrils near the ground. In these crude and puerile speculations we have the beginning of mental philosophy.

Modern discoveries as to the relations of the air.

I cannot dismiss the system of the Apollonian without setting in contrast with it the discoveries of modern science respecting the relations of the air. Toward the world of life it stands in a position of wonderful interest. Decomposed into its constituents by the skill of chemistry, it is no longer looked upon as a homogeneous body; its ingredients have not only been separated, but the functions they discharge have been ascertained. From one of these, carbonic acid, all the various forms of plants arise; that substance being decomposed by the rays of the sun, and furnishing to vegetables carbon, their chief solid ingredient. All those beautifully diversified organic productions, from the mosses of the icy regions to the palms characteristic of the landscapes of the tropics—all those we cast away as worthless weeds, and those for the obtaining of which we Inter-dependence of animals and plants. expend the sweat of our brow—all, without any exception, are obtained from the atmosphere by the influence of the sun. And since without plants the life of animals could not be maintained, they constitute the means by which the aËrial material, vivified, as it may be said, by the rays of the sun, is conveyed even into the composition of man himself. As food, they serve to repair the waste of the body necessarily occasioned in the acts of moving and thinking. For a time, therefore, these ingredients, once a part of the structure of plants, enter as essential constituents in the structure of animals. Yet it is only in a momentary way, for the essential condition of animal activity is that there shall be unceasing interstitial death; not a finger can be lifted without the waste of muscular material; not a thought arise without the destruction of cerebral substance. From the animal system the products of decay are forthwith removed, often by mechanisms of the most exquisite construction; but their uses are not ended, for sooner or later they find their way back again into the air, and again serve for the origination of plants. It is needless to trace these changes in all their details; the same order or cycle of progress holds good for the water, the ammonia; they pass from the inorganic to the living state, and back to the inorganic again; now the same particle is found in the air next aiding in the composition of a plant, then in the body of an animal, and back in the air once more. In this perpetual Agency of the sun. revolution material particles run, the dominating influence determining and controlling their movement being in that great centre of our system, the sun. From him, in the summer days, plants receive, and, as it were, store up that warmth which, at a subsequent time, is to reappear in the glow of health of man, or to be rekindled in the blush of shame, or to consume in the burning fever. Nor is there any limit of time. The heat we derive from the combustion of stubble came from the sun as it were only yesterday; but that with which we moderate the rigour of winter when we burn anthracite or bituminous coal was also derived from the same source in the ultra-tropical climate of the secondary times, perhaps a thousand centuries ago.

In such perpetually recurring cycles are the movements of material things accomplished, and all takes place under the dominion of invariable law. The air is the source whence all organisms have come; it is the receptacle to which they all return. Its parts are awakened into life, not by the influence of any terrestrial agency or principle concealed in itself, as Diogenes supposed, but by a star which is ninety millions of miles distant, the source, direct or indirect, of every terrestrial movement, and the dispenser of light and life.

Heraclitus asserts that fire is the first principle.

To Thales and Diogenes, whose primordial elements were water and air respectively, we must add Heraclitus of Ephesus, who maintained that the first principle is fire. He illustrated the tendency which Greek philosophy had already assumed of opposition to Polytheism and the idolatrous practices of the age. It is said that in his work, ethical, political, physical, and theological subjects were so confused, and so great was the difficulty of understanding his meaning, that he obtained the surname of "the Obscure." In this respect he has had among modern metaphysicians many successors. He founds his system, however, upon the simple axiom that "all is convertible into fire, and fire into all." Perhaps by the term fire he understood what is at present meant by heat, for he expressly says that The fictitious permanence of successive forms. he does not mean flame, but something merely dry and warm. He considered that this principle is in a state of perpetual activity, forming and absorbing every individual thing. He says, "All is, and is not; for though it does in truth come into being, yet it forthwith ceases to be." "No one has ever been twice on the same stream, for different waters are constantly flowing down. It dissipates its waters and gathers them again; it approaches and recedes, overflows and fails." And to teach us that we ourselves are changing and have changed, he says, "On the same stream we embark and embark not, we are and we are not." By such illustrations he implies that life is only an unceasing motion, and we cannot fail to remark that the Greek turn of thought is fast following that of the Hindu.

But Heraclitus totally fails to free himself from local conceptions. He speaks of the motion of the primordial principle in the upward and downward directions, in the higher and lower regions. He says that the chief accumulation thereof is above, and the chief deficiency below: and hence he regards the soul of a man as a portion of fire migrated from heaven. He carries his ideas of the transitory nature of all phenomena to their last consequences, and illustrates the noble doctrine that all which appears to us to be permanent is only a regulated and self-renewing concurrence of similar and opposite motions by such extravagances as that the sun is daily destroyed and renewed.

Physical and physiological doctrines of Heraclitus.

In the midst of many wild physical statements many true axioms are delivered. "All is ordered by reason and intelligence, though all is subject to Fate." Already he perceived what the metaphysicians of our own times are illustrating, that "man's mind can produce no certain knowledge from its own interior resources alone." He regarded the organs of sense as being the channels through which the outer life of the world, and therewith truth, enters into the mind, and that in sleep, when the organs of sense are closed, we are shut out from all communion with the surrounding universal spirit. In his view every thing is animated and insouled, but to different degrees, organic objects being most completely or perfectly so. His astronomy may be anticipated from what has been said respecting the sun, which he moreover regarded as being scarcely more than a foot in diameter, and, like all other celestial objects, a mere meteor. His moral system was altogether based upon the physical, the fundamental dogma being the excellence of fire. Thus he accounted for the imbecility of the drunkard by his having a moist soul, and drew the inference that a warm or dry soul is the wisest and best; with justifiable patriotism asserting that the noblest souls must belong to a climate that is dry, intending thereby to indicate that Greece is man's fittest and truest country. There can be no doubt that in Heraclitus there is a strong tendency to the doctrine of a soul of the world. If the divinity is undistinguishable from heat, whither can we go to escape its influences? And in the restless activity and incessant changes it produces in every thing within our reach, do we not recognize the tokens of the illimitable and unshackled?

The puerility of Ionian philosophy.

I have lingered on the chief features of the early Greek philosophy as exhibited in the physical school of Ionia. They serve to impress upon us its intrinsic imperfection. It is a mixture of the physical, metaphysical, and mystical which, upon the whole, has no other value than this, that it shows how feeble were the beginnings of our knowledge—that we commenced with the importation of a few vulgar errors from Egypt. In presence of the utilitarian philosophy of that country and the theology of India, how vain and even childish are these germs of science in Greece! Yet this very imperfection is not without its use, since it warns us of the inferior position in which we stand as respects the time of our civilization when compared with those ancient states, and teaches us to reject the assertion which so many European scholars have wearied themselves in establishing, that Greece led the way to all human knowledge of any value. Above all, it impresses upon us more appropriate, because more humble views of our present attainments and position, and gives us to understand that other races of men not only preceded us in intellectual culture, but have equalled, and perhaps surpassed every thing that we have yet done in mental philosophy.

Anaximander's doctrine of the Infinite.

Of the other founders of Ionic sects it may be observed that, though they gave to their doctrines different forms, the method of reasoning was essentially the same in them all. Of this a better illustration could not be given than in the philosophy of Anaximander of Miletus, who was contemporary with Thales. He started with the postulate that things arose by separation from a universal mixture of all: his primordial principle was therefore chaos, though he veiled it in the metaphysically obscure designation "The Infinite." The want of precision in this respect gave rise to much difference of opinion as to his tenets. To his chaos he imputed an internal energy, by which its parts spontaneously separated from each other; to those parts he imputed absolute unchangeability. He taught that the earth is of a cylindrical form, its base being one-third of its altitude; it is retained in the centre of the world by the air in an equality of distance from all the boundaries of the universe; that the fixed stars and planets revolved round it, each being fastened to a crystalline ring; and beyond them, in like manner, the moon, and, still farther off, the sun. He Origin of cosmogony. conceived of an opposition between the central and circumferential regions, the former being naturally cold, and the latter hot; indeed, in his opinion, the settling of the cold parts to the centre, and the ascending of the hot, gave origin, respectively, to the formation of the earth and shining celestial bodies, the latter first existing as a complete shell or sphere, which, undergoing destruction, broke up into stars. Already we perceive the tendency of Greek philosophy to shape itself into systems of cosmogony, founded upon the disturbance Origin of biology. of the chaotic matter by heat and cold. Nay, more, Anaximander explained the origin of living creatures on like principles, for the sun's heat, acting upon the primal miry earth, produced filmy bladders or bubbles, and these, becoming surrounded with a prickly rind, at length burst open, and, as from an egg, animals came forth. At first they were ill-formed and imperfect, but subsequently elaborated and developed. As to man, so far from being produced in his perfect shape, he was ejected as a fish, and under that form continued in the muddy water until he was capable of supporting himself on dry land. Besides "the Infinite" being thus the cause of generation, it was also the cause of destruction: "things must all return whence they came, according to destiny, for they must all, in order of time, undergo due penalties and expiations of wrong-doing." This expression obviously contains a moral consideration, and is an exemplification of the commencing feeble interconnection between physical and moral philosophy.

As to the more solid discoveries attributed to this philosopher, we may dispose of them in the same manner that we have dealt with the like facts in the biographies of his predecessors—they are idle inventions of his vainglorious countrymen. That he was the first to make maps is scarcely consistent with the well-known fact that the Egyptians had cultivated geometry for that express purpose thirty centuries before he was born. As to his inventing sun-dials, the shadow had gone back on that of Ahaz a long time before. In reality, the sun-dial was a very ancient Oriental invention. And as to his being the first to make an exact calculation of the size and distance of the heavenly bodies, it need only be remarked that those who have so greatly extolled his labours must have overlooked how incompatible such discoveries are with a system which assumes that the earth is cylindrical in shape, and kept in the midst of the heavens by the atmosphere; that the sun is farther off than the fixed stars; and that each of the heavenly bodies is made to revolve by means of a crystalline wheel.

The philosopher whose views we have next to consider is Anaxagoras of Clazomene, the friend and master of Pericles, Euripides, and Socrates. Like several of his predecessors, he had visited Egypt. Among his disciples were numbered some of the most eminent men of those times.

Anaxagoras teaches the unchangeability of the universe.

The fundamental principle of his philosophy was the recognition of the unchangeability of the universe as a whole, the variety of forms that we see being produced by new arrangements of its constituent parts. Such a doctrine includes, of course, the idea of the eternity of matter. Anaxagoras says, "Wrongly do the Greeks suppose that aught begins or ceases to be, for nothing comes into being or is destroyed, but all is an aggregation or secretion of pre-existent things, so that all becoming might more correctly be called becoming-mixed, and all corruption becoming-separate." In such a statement we cannot fail to remark that the Greek is fast passing into the track of the Egyptian and the Hindu. In some respects his views recall those of the chaos of Anaximander, as when he says, "Together were The primal intellect. all things infinite in number and smallness; nothing was distinguishable. Before they were sorted, while all was together, there was no quality noticeable." To the first moving force which arranged the parts of things out of the chaos, he gave the designation of "the Intellect," rejecting Fate as an empty name, and imputing all things to Reason. He made no distinction between the Soul and Intellect. His tenets evidently include a dualism indicated by the moving force and the moved mass, an opposition between the corporeal and mental. This indicated that for philosophy there are two separate routes, the physical and intellectual. While Reason is thus the prime mover in his philosophy, he likewise employed many subordinate agents in the government of things—for instance, air, water, and fire, being evidently unable to explain the state of nature in a satisfactory way by the Cosmogony of Anaxagoras. operation of the Intellect alone. We recognize in the details of his system ideas derived from former ones, such as the settling of the cold and dense below, and the rising of the warm and light above. In the beginning the action of Intellect was only partial; that which was primarily moved was only imperfectly sorted, and contained in itself the capability of many separations. From this point his system became a cosmogony, showing how the elements and fogs, stones, stars, and the sea, were produced. These explanations, as mighty be anticipated, have no exactness. Among his primary elements are many incongruous things, such as cold, colour, fire, gold, lead, corn, marrow, blood, &c. This doctrine implied that in compound things there was not a formation, but an arrangement. It required, therefore, many elements instead of a single one. Flesh is made of fleshy particles, bones of bony, gold of golden, lead of leaden, wood of wooden, &c. These analogous constituents are homoeomeriÆ. Of an infinite number of kinds, they composed the infinite all, which is a mixture of them. From such conditions Anaxagoras proves that all the parts of an animal body pre-exist in the food, and are merely collected therefrom. As to the phenomena of life, he explains it on his doctrine of dualism between mind and matter; he teaches that sleep is produced by the reaction of the latter on the former. Even plants he regards as only rooted animals, motionless, but having sensations and desires; he imputes the superiority of man to the mere fact of his having hands. He explains our mental perceptions upon the hypothesis that we have naturally within us the contraries of all the qualities of external things; and that, when we consider an object, we become aware of the preponderance of those qualities in our mind which are deficient in it. Hence all sensation is attended with pain. His doctrine of the production of animals was founded on the action of the sunlight on the miry earth. The earth he places in the centre of the world, whither it was carried by a whirlwind, the pole being originally in the zenith; but, when animals issued from the mud, its position was changed by the Intellect, so that there might be suitable climates. In some particulars his crude guesses present amusing anticipations of subsequent discoveries. Thus he maintained that the moon has mountains, and valleys like the earth; that there have been grand epochs in the history of our globe, in which it has been successively modified by fire and water; that the hills of Lampsacus would one day be under the sea, if time did not too soon fail.

Doubts whether we have any criterion of truth.

As to the nature of human knowledge, Anaxagoras, asserted that by the Intellect alone do we become acquainted with the truth, the senses being altogether untrustworthy. He illustrated this by putting a drop of coloured liquid into a quantity of clear water, the eye being unable to recognize any change. Upon such principles also he asserted that snow is not white, but black, since it is composed of water, of which the colour is black; and hence he drew such conclusions as that "things are to each man according as they seem to him." It was doubtless the recognition of the unreliability of the senses that extorted from him the well-known complaint: "Nothing can be known; nothing can be learned; nothing can be certain; sense is limited; intellect is weak; life is short."

Anaxagoras is persecuted.

The biography of Anaxagoras is not without interest. Born in affluence, he devoted all his means to philosophy, and in his old age encountered poverty and want. He was accused by the superstitious Athenian populace of Atheism and impiety to the gods, since he asserted that the sun and moon consist of earth and stone, and that the so-called divine miracles of the times were nothing more than common natural effects. For these reasons, and also because of the Magianism of his doctrine—for he taught the antagonism of mind and matter, a dogma of the detested Persians—he was thrown into prison, condemned to death, and barely escaped through the influence of Pericles. He fled to Lampsacus, where he ended his days in exile. His vainglorious countrymen, however, conferred honour upon his memory in their customary exaggerated way, boasting that he was the first to explain the phases of the moon, the nature of solar and lunar eclipses, that he had the power of foretelling future events, and had even predicted the fall of a meteoric stone.

From the biography of Anaxagoras, as well as of several of his contemporaries and successors, we may learn that a popular opposition was springing up against philosophy, not limited to a mere social protest, but carried out into political injustice. The antagonism between learning and Polytheism was becoming every day more distinct. Of the philosophers, some were obliged to flee into exile, some suffered death. The natural result of such a state of things was to force them to practise concealment and mystification, as is strikingly shown in the history of the Pythagoreans.

Pythagoras, biography of.

Of Pythagoras, the founder of this sect, but little is known with certainty; even the date of his birth is contested, probably he was born at Samos about B.C. 540. If we were not expressly told so, we should recognize from his doctrines that he had been in Egypt and India. Some eminent scholars, who desire on all occasions to magnify the learning of ancient Europe, depreciate as far as they can the universal testimony of antiquity that such was the origin of the knowledge of Pythagoras, asserting that the constitution of the Egyptian priesthood rendered it impossible for a foreigner to become initiated. They forget that the ancient system of that country had been totally destroyed in the great revolution which took place more than a century before those times. If it were not explicitly stated by the ancients that Pythagoras lived for twenty-two years in Egypt, there is sufficient internal evidence in his story to prove that he had been there a long time. As a connoisseur can detect the hand of a master by the style of a picture, so one who has devoted attention to the old systems of thought sees, at a glance, the Egyptian in the philosophy of Pythagoras.

He passed into Italy during the reign of Tarquin the Proud, and settled at Crotona, a Greek colonial city on the Bay of Tarentum. At first he established a school, but, favoured by local dissensions, he gradually organized from the youths who availed themselves of his instructions a secret political society. Already it had passed into a maxim among the learned Greeks that it is not advantageous to communicate knowledge too freely to the people—a bitter experience in persecutions seemed to demonstrate that the maxim was founded on truth. The step from a secret philosophical society to a political conspiracy is but short. Pythagoras appears to have taken it. The disciples who were admitted to his scientific secrets after a period of probation and process of examination constituted a ready instrument of intrigue against the state, the issue of which, after a time, appeared in the supplanting of the ancient senate and the exaltation of Pythagoras and his club to the administration of government. The actions of men in all times are determined by similar principles; and as it would be now with such a conspiracy, so it was then; for, though the Pythagorean influence spread from Crotona to other Italian towns, an overwhelming reaction soon set in, the innovators were driven into exile, their institutions destroyed, and their founder fell a victim to his enemies.

The organization attempted by the Pythagoreans is an exception to the general policy of the Greeks. The philosophical schools had been merely points of reunion for those entertaining similar opinions; but in the state they can hardly be regarded as having had any political existence.

His miracles.

It is difficult, when the political or religious feelings of men have been engaged, to ascertain the truth of events in which they have been concerned; deception, and falsehood, seem to be licensed. In the midst of the troubles befalling Italy as the consequence of these Pythagorean machinations, it is impossible to ascertain facts with certainty. One party exalts Pythagoras to a superhuman state; it pictures him majestic and impassive, clothed in robes of white, with a golden coronet around his brows, listening to the music of the spheres, or seeking relaxation in the more humble hymns of Homer, Hesiod, and Thales; lost in the contemplation of Nature, or rapt in ecstasy in his meditations on God; manifesting his descent from Apollo or Hermes by the working of miracles, predicting future events, conversing with genii in the solitude of a dark cavern, and even surpassing the wonder of speaking simultaneously in different tongues, since it was established, by the most indisputable testimony, that he had accomplished the prodigy of being present with and addressing the people in several different places at the same time. It seems not to have occurred to his disciples that such preposterous assertions cannot be sustained by any evidence whatsoever; and that the stronger and clearer such evidence is, instead of supporting the fact for which it is brought forward, it the more serves to shake our confidence in the truth of man, or impresses on us the conclusion that he is easily lead to the adoption of falsehood, and is readily deceived by imposture.

By his opponents he was denounced as a quack, or, at the best, a visionary mystic, who had deluded the young with the mummeries of a free-masonry; had turned the weak-minded into shallow enthusiasts and grim ascetics; and as having conspired against a state which had given him an honourable refuge, and brought disorder and bloodshed upon it. Between such contradictory statements, it is difficult to determine how much we should impute to the philosopher and how much to the trickster. In this uncertainty, the Pythagoreans reap the fruit of one of their favourite maxims, "Not unto all should all be made known." Perhaps at the bottom of these political movements lay the hope of establishing a central point of union for the numerous Greek colonies of Italy, which, though they were rich and highly civilized, were, by reason of their isolation and antagonism, essentially weak. Could they have been united in a powerful federation by the aid of some political or religious bond, they might have exerted a singular influence on the rising fortunes of Rome, and thereby on humanity.

Pythagoras asserts that number is the first principle.

The fundamental dogma of the Pythagoreans was that "number is the essence or first principle of things." This led them at once to the study of the mysteries of figures and of arithmetical relations, and plunged them into the wildest fantasies when it took the absurd form that numbers are actually things. The approval of the doctrines of Pythagoras so generally expressed was doubtless very much due to the fact that they supplied an intellectual void. Those who had been in the foremost ranks of philosophy had come to the conclusion that, as regard external things, and even ourselves, we have no criterion of truth; but in the properties of numbers and their relations, such a criterion does exist.

Pythagorean philosophy.

It would scarcely repay the reader to pursue this system in its details; a very superficial representation of it is all that is necessary for our purpose. It recognizes two species of numbers, the odd and even; and since one, or unity, must be at once both odd and even, it must be the very essence of number, and the ground of all other numbers; hence the meaning of the Pythagorean expression, "All comes from one;" which also took form in the mystical allusion, "God embraces all and actuates all, and is but one." To the number ten extraordinary importance was imputed, since it contains in itself, or arises from the addition of, 1, 2, 3, 4—that is, of even and odd numbers together; hence it received the name of the grand tetractys, because it so contains the first four numbers. Some, however, assert that that designation was imposed on the number thirty-six. To the triad the Pythagoreans likewise attached much significance, since it has a beginning, a middle, and an end. To unity, or one, they gave the designation of the even-odd, asserting that it contained the property both of the even and odd, as is plain from the fact that if one be added to an even number it becomes odd, but if to an odd number it becomes even. They arranged the primary elements of nature in a table of ten contraries, of which the odd and even are one, and light and darkness another. They said that "the nature and energy of number may be traced not only in divine and dÆmonish things, but in human works and words everywhere, and in all works of art and in music." They even linked their arithmetical views to morality, through the observation that numbers never lie; that they are hostile to falsehood; and that, therefore, truth belongs to their family: their fanciful speculations led them to infer that in the limitless or infinite, falsehood and envy must reign. From similar reasoning, they concluded that the number one contained not only the perfect, but also the imperfect; hence it follows that the most good, most beautiful, and most true are not at the beginning, but that they are in the process of time evolved. They held that whatever we know must have had a beginning, a middle, and an end, of which the beginning and end are the boundaries or limits; but the middle is unlimited, and, as a consequence, may be subdivided ad infinitum. They therefore resolved corporeal existence into points, as is set forth in their maxim that "all is composed of points or spacial units, which, taken together, constitute a number." Such being their ideas of the limiting which constitutes the extreme, they understood by the unlimited the intermediate space or interval. By the aid of these intervals they obtained a conception of space; for, since the units, or monads, as they were also called, are merely geometrical points, no number of them could produce a line, but by the union of monads and intervals conjointly a line can arise, and also a surface, and also a solid. As to the interval thus existing between monads, some considered it as being mere aËrial breath, but the orthodox regarded it as a vacuum; hence we perceive the meaning of their absurd affirmation that all things are produced by a vacuum. As it is not to be overlooked that the monads are merely mathematical points, and have no dimensions or size, substances actually contain no matter, and are nothing more than forms.

Pythagorean cosmogony.

The Pythagoreans applied these principles to account for the origin of the world, saying that, since its very existence is an illusion, it could not have any origin in time, but only seemingly so to human thought. As to time itself, they regarded it as "existing only by the distinction of a series of different moments, which, however, are again restored to unity by the limiting moments." The diversity of relations we find in the world they supposed to be occasioned by the bond of harmony. "Since the principles of things are neither similar nor congenerous, it is impossible for them to be brought into order except by the intervention of harmony, whatever may have been the manner in which it took place. Like and homogeneous things, indeed, would not have required harmony; but, as to the dissimilar and unsymmetrical, such must necessarily be held together by harmony if they are to be contained in a world of order." In this manner they confused together the ideas of number and harmony, regarding the world not only as a combination of contraries, but as an orderly and harmonical combination thereof. To particular numbers they therefore imputed great significance, asserting that "there are seven chords or harmonies, seven pleiads, seven vowels, and that certain parts of the bodies of animals change in the course of seven years." They carried to an extreme the numerical doctrine, assigning certain numbers as the representatives of a bird, a horse, a man. This doctrine may be illustrated Modern Pythagorisms in chemistry. by facts familiar to chemists, who, in like manner, attach significant numbers to the names of things. Taking hydrogen as unity, 6 belongs to carbon, 8 to oxygen, 16 to sulphur. Carrying those principles out, there is no substance, elementary or compound, inorganic or organic, to which an expressive number does not belong. Nay, even an archetypal form, as of man or any other such composite structure, may thus possess a typical number, the sum of the numbers of its constituent parts. It signifies nothing what interpretation we give to these numbers, whether we regarded them as atomic weights, or, declining the idea of atoms, consider them as the representatives of force. As in the ancient philosophical doctrine, so in modern science, the number is invariably connected with the name of a thing, of whatever description the thing may be.

The grand standard of harmonical relation among the Pythagoreans was the musical octave. Physical qualities, such as colour and tone, were supposed to appertain to the surface of bodies. Of the elements they enumerated five—earth, air, fire, water, and ether, connecting therewith the fact that man has five organs of sense. Of the planets they numbered five, which, together with the sun, moon, and earth, are placed apart at distances determined by a musical law, and in their movements through space give rise to a sound, the harmony of the spheres, unnoticed by us because we habitually hear it. They place the sun Pythagorean physics and psychology. in the centre of the system, round which, with the other planets, the earth revolves. At this point the geocentric doctrine is being abandoned and the heliocentric takes its place. As the circle is the most perfect of forms, the movements of the planets are circular. They maintained that the moon is inhabited, and like the earth, but the people there are taller than men, in the proportion as the moon's periodic rotation is greater than that of the earth. They explained the Milky Way as having been occasioned by the fall of a star, or as having been formerly the path of the sun. They asserted that the world is eternal, but the earth is transitory and liable to change, the universe being in the shape of a sphere. They held that the soul of man is merely an efflux of the universal soul, and that it comes into the body from without. From dreams and the events of sickness they inferred the existence of good and evil dÆmons. They supposed that souls can exist without the body, leading a kind of dream-life, and identified the motes in the sunbeam with them. Their heroes and dÆmons were souls not yet become embodied, or who had ceased to be so. The doctrine of transmigration which they had adopted was in harmony with such views, and, if it does not imply the absolute immortality of the soul, at least asserts its existence after the death of the body, for the disembodied spirit becomes incarnate again as soon as it finds a tenement which fits it. To their life after death the Pythagoreans added a doctrine of retributive rewards and punishments, and, in this respect, what has been said of animals forming a penitential mechanism in the theology of India and Egypt, holds good for the Pythagoreans too.

Of their system of politics nothing can now with certainty be affirmed beyond the fact that its prime element was an aristocracy; of their rule of private life, but little beyond its including a recommendation of moderation in all things, the cultivation of friendship, the observance of faith, and the practice of self-denial, promoted by ascetic exercises. It was a maxim with them that a right education is not only of importance to the individual, but also to the interests of the state. Pythagoras himself, as is well known, paid much attention to the determination of extension and gravity, the ratios of musical tones, astronomy, and medicine. He directed his disciples, in their orgies or secret worship, to practise gymnastics, dancing, music. In correspondence with his principle of imparting to men only such knowledge as they were fitted to receive, he communicated to those who were less perfectly prepared exoteric doctrines, reserving the esoteric for the privileged few who had passed five years in silence, had endured humiliation, and been purged by self-denial and sacrifice.

The Eleatic philosophy.

We have now reached the consideration of the Eleatic philosophy. It differs from the preceding in its neglect of material things, and its devotion to the supra-sensible. It derives its name from Elea, a Greek colonial city of Italy, its chief authors being Xenophanes, Parmenides, and Zeno.

Xenophanes represents a great philosophical advance.

Xenophanes was a native of Ionia, from which having been exiled, he appears to have settled at last in Elea, after leading for many years the life of a wandering rhapsodist. He gave his doctrines a poetical form for the purpose of more easily diffusing them. To the multitude he became conspicuous from his opposition to Homer, Hesiod, and other popular poets, whom he denounced for promoting the base polytheism of the times, and degrading the idea of the divine by the immoralities they attributed to the gods. He proclaimed God as an all-powerful Being, existing from eternity, and without any likeness to man. A strict monotheist, he denounced the plurality of gods as an inconceivable error, asserting that of the all-powerful and all-perfect there could not, in the nature of things, be more than one; for, if there were only so many as two, those attributes could not apply to one of them, much less, then, if there were many. This one principle or power was to him the same as the universe, the substance of which, having existed from all eternity, must necessarily be identical with God; for, since it is impossible that there should be two Omnipresents, so also it is impossible that there should be two Eternals. It therefore may be said that there is a tincture of Orientalism in his ideas, since it would scarcely be possible to offer a more succinct and luminous exposition of the pantheism of India.

He approaches the Indian ideas.

The reader who has been wearied with the frivolities of the Ionian philosophy, and lost in the mysticisms of Pythagoras, cannot fail to recognize that here we have something of a very different kind. To an Oriental dignity of conception is added an extraordinary clearness and precision of reasoning.

Theology of Xenophanes.

To Xenophanes all revelation is a pure fiction; the discovery of the invisible is to be made by the intellect of man alone. The vulgar belief which imputes to the Deity the sentiments, passions, and crimes of man, is blasphemous and accursed. He exposes the impiety of those who would figure the Great Supreme under the form of a man, telling them that if the ox or the lion could rise to a conception of the Deity, they might as well embody him under their own shape; that the negro represents him with a flat nose and black face; the Thracian with blue eyes and a ruddy complexion. "There is but one God; he has no resemblance to the bodily form of man, nor are his thoughts like ours." He taught that God is without parts, and throughout alike; for, if he had parts, some would be ruled by others, and others would rule, which is impossible, for the very notion of God implies his perfect and thorough sovereignty. Throughout he must be Reason, and Intelligence, and Omnipotence, "ruling the universe without trouble by Reason and Insight." He conceived that the Supreme understands by a sensual perception, and not only thinks, but sees and hears throughout. In a symbolical manner he represented God as a sphere, like the heavens, which encompass man and all earthly things.

His physical views.

In his natural philosophy it is said that he adopted the four elements, Earth, Air, Fire, Water; though by some it is asserted that, from observing fossil fish, on the tops of mountains, he was led to the belief that the earth itself arose from water; and generally, that the phenomena of nature originate in combinations of the primary elements. From such views he inferred that all things are necessarily transitory, and that men, and even the earth itself, must pass away. As to the latter, he regarded it as a flat surface, the inferior region of which extends indefinitely downward, and so gives a solid foundation. His physical views he, however, held with a doubt almost bordering on scepticism: "No mortal man ever did, or ever shall know God and the universe thoroughly; for, since error is so spread over all things, it is impossible for us to be certain even when we utter the true and the perfect." It seemed to him hopeless that man could ever ascertain the truth, since he has no other aid than truthless appearances.

I cannot dismiss this imperfect account of Xenophanes, who was, undoubtedly, one of the greatest of the Greek philosophers, without an allusion to his denunciation of Homer, and other poets of his country, because they had aided in degrading the idea of the Divinity; and also to his faith in human nature, his rejection of the principle of concealing truth from the multitude, and his self-devotion in diffusing it among all at a risk of liberty and life. He wandered from country to country, withstanding polytheism to its face, and imparting wisdom in rhapsodies and hymns, the form, above all others, calculated most quickly in those times to spread knowledge abroad. To those who are disposed to depreciate his philosophical conclusions, it may be remarked that in some of their most striking features they have been reproduced in modern times, and I would offer to them a quotation from the Some of his thoughts reappear in Newton. General Scholium at the end of the third book of the Principia of Newton: "The Supreme God exists necessarily, and by the same necessity he exists always and everywhere. Whence, also, he is all similar, all eye, all ear, all brain, all arm, all power to perceive, to understand, and to act, but in a manner not at all human, not at all corporeal; in a manner utterly unknown to us. As a blind man has no idea of colours, so have we no idea of the manner by which the all-wise God perceives and understands all things. He is utterly void of all body and bodily figure, and can therefore neither be seen, nor heard, nor touched, nor ought to be worshipped under the representation of any corporeal thing. We have ideas of his attributes, but what the real substance of anything is we know not."

To the Eleatic system thus originating with Xenophanes is to be attributed the dialectic phase henceforward so prominently exhibited by Greek philosophy. It abandoned, for the most part, the pursuits which had occupied the Ionians—the investigation of visible nature, the phenomena of material things, and the laws presiding over them; conceiving such to be merely deceptive, and attaching itself to what seemed to be the only true knowledge—an investigation of Being and of God. By the Eleats, since all change appeared to be an impossibility, the phenomena of succession presented by the world were Parmenides on reason and opinion. regarded as a pure illusion, and they asserted that Time, and Motion, and Space are phantasms of the imagination, or vain deceptions of the senses. They therefore separated reason from opinion, attributing to the former conceptions of absolute truth, and to the latter imperfections arising from the fictions of sense. It was on this principle that Parmenides divided his work on "Nature" into two books, the first on Reason, the second on Opinion. Starting from the nature of Being, the uncreated and unchangeable, he denied altogether the idea of succession in time, and also the relations of space, and pronounced change and motion, of whatever kind they Philosophy becoming Pantheism. may be, mere illusions of opinion. His pantheism appears in the declaration that the All is thought and intelligence; and this, indeed, constitutes the essential feature of his doctrine, for, by thus placing thought and being in parallelism with each other, and interconnecting them by the conception that it is for the sake of being that thought exists, he showed that they must necessarily be conceived of as one.

Such profound doctrines occupied the first book of the poem of Parmenides; in the second he treated of opinion, which, as we have said, is altogether dependent on the senses, and therefore untrustworthy, not, however, that it must necessarily be absolutely false. It is scarcely possible for us to reconstruct from the remains of his works the details of his theory, or to show his approach to the Ionian doctrines by the assumption of the existence in nature of two opposite species—ethereal fire and heavy night; of an equal proportion of which all things consist, fire being the true, and night the phenomenal. From such an unsubstantial and delusive basis it would not repay us, even if we had the means of accomplishing it, to give an exposition of his physical system. In many respects it degenerated into a wild vagary; as, for example, when he placed an overruling dÆmon in the centre of the phenomenal world. Nor need we be detained by his extravagant reproduction of the old doctrine of the generation of animals from miry clay, nor follow his explanation of the nature of man, who, since he is composed of light and darkness, participates in both, and can never ascertain absolute truth. By other routes, and upon far less fanciful principles, modern philosophy has at last come to the same melancholy conclusion.

Doctrines of Parmenides carried out by Zeno;

The doctrines of Parmenides were carried out by Zeno the Eleatic, who is said to have been his adopted son. He brought into use the method of refuting error by the reductio ad absurdum. His compositions were in prose, and not in poetry, as were those of his predecessors. As it had been the object of Parmenides to establish the existence of "the One," it was the object of Zeno to establish the non-existence of "the Many." Agreeably to such principles, he started from the position that only one thing really exists, and that all others are mere modifications or appearances of it. He denied motion, but admitted the appearance of it; regarding it as a name given to a series of conditions, each of which is necessarily rest. This dogma against the possibility of motion he maintained by four arguments; the second of them is the celebrated Achilles puzzle. It is thus stated: "Suppose Achilles to run ten times as fast as a tortoise, yet, if the tortoise has the start, Achilles can never overtake him; for, if they are separated at first by an interval of a thousand feet, when Achilles has run these thousand feet the tortoise will have run a hundred, and when Achilles has run these hundred the tortoise will have got on ten, and so on for ever; therefore Achilles may run for ever without overtaking the tortoise." Such were his arguments against the existence of motion; his proof of the existence of One, the indivisible and infinite, may thus be stated: "To suppose that the one is divisible is to suppose it finite. If divisible, it must be infinitely divisible. But suppose two things to exist, then there must necessarily be an interval between those two—something separating and limiting them. What is that something? It is some other thing. But then if not the same thing, it also must be separated and limited, and so on ad infinitum. Thus only one thing can exist as the substratum for all manifold appearances." Zeno furnishes us with an illustration of the fallibility of the indications of sense in his argument against Protagoras. It may be here introduced as a specimen of his method: "He asked if a grain of corn, or the ten thousandth part of a grain, would, when it fell to the ground, make a noise. Being answered in the negative, he further asked whether, then, would a measure of corn. This being necessarily affirmed, he then demanded whether the measure was not in some determinate ratio to the single grain; as this could not be denied, he was able to conclude, either, then, the bushel of corn makes no noise on falling, or else the very smallest portion of a grain does the same."

and by Melissus of Samos.

To the names already given as belonging to the Eleatic school may be added that of Melissus of Samos, who also founded his argument on the nature of Being, deducing its unity, unchangeability, and indivisibility. He denied, like the rest of his school, all change and motion, regarding them as mere illusions of the senses. From the indivisibility of being he inferred its incorporeality, and therefore denied all bodily existence.

Biography of Empedocles.

The list of Eleatic philosophers is doubtfully closed by the name of Empedocles of Agrigentum, who in legend almost rivals Pythagoras. In the East he learned medicine and magic, the art of working miracles, of producing rain and wind. He decked himself in priestly garments, a golden girdle, and a crown, proclaiming himself to be a god. It is said by some that he never died, but ascended to the skies in the midst of a supernatural glory. By some it is related that he leaped into the crater of Etna, that, the manner of his death being unknown, he might still continue to pass for a god—an expectation disappointed by an eruption which cast out one of his brazen sandals.

Agreeably to the school to which he belonged, he relied on Reason and distrusted the Senses. From his fragments it has been inferred that he was sceptical of the guidance of the former as well as of the latter, founding his distrust on the imperfection the soul has contracted, and for which it has been condemned to existence in this world, and even to transmigration from body to body. Adopting the Eleatic doctrine that like can be only known by like, fire He mingles mysticism with philosophy. by fire, love by love, the recognition of the divine by man is sufficient proof that the Divine exists. His primary elements were four—Earth, Air, Fire, and Water; to these he added two principles, Love and Hate. The four elements he regarded as four gods, or divine eternal forces, since out of them all things are made. Love he regards as the creative power, the destroyer or modifier being Hate. It is obvious, therefore, that in him the strictly philosophical system of Xenophanes had degenerated into a mixed and mystical view, in which the physical, the metaphysical, and the moral were confounded together; and that, as the necessary consequence of such a state, the principles of knowledge were becoming unsettled, a suspicion arising that all philosophical systems were untrustworthy, and a general scepticism was already setting in.

To this result also, in no small degree, the labours of Democritus of Abdera tended. He had had the advantages derived from wealth in the procurement of knowledge, for it is said that his father was rich enough to be able to entertain the Persian King Xerxes, who was so gratified thereby that he left several Magi and ChaldÆans to complete the education of the youth. On his father's death, Democritus, dividing with his brothers the estate, took as his portion the share consisting of money, leaving to them the lands, that he might be better able to devote himself to travelling. He passed into Egypt, Ethiopia, Persia, and India, gathering knowledge from all those sources.

Democritus asserts the untrustworthiness of knowledge.

According to Democritus, "Nothing is true, or, if so, is not certain to us." Nevertheless, as, in his system sensation constitutes thought, and, at the same time, is but a change in the sentient being, "sensations are of necessity true;" from which somewhat obscure passage we may infer that, in the view of Democritus, though sensation is true subjectively, it is not true objectively. The sweet, the bitter, the hot, the cold, are simply creations of the mind; but in the outer object to which we append them, atoms and space alone exist, and our opinion of the properties of such objects is founded upon images emitted by them falling upon the senses. Confounding in this manner sensation with thought, and making them identical, he, moreover, included Reflexion as necessary for true knowledge, Sensation by itself being untrustworthy. Thus, though Sensation may indicate to us that sweet, bitter, hot, cold, occur in bodies, Reflexion teaches us that this is altogether an illusion, and that, in reality, atoms and space alone exist.

Devoting his attention, then, to the problem of perception—how the mind becomes aware of the existence of external things—he resorted to the hypothesis that they constantly throw off images of themselves, which are assimilated by the air through which they have to pass, and enter the soul by pores in its sensitive organs. Hence such images, being merely of the superficial form, are necessarily imperfect and untrue, and so, therefore, must be the knowledge yielded by them. Democritus rejected the one element of the Eleatics, affirming that there must He introduces the atomic theory. be many; but he did not receive the four of Empedocles, nor his principles of Love and Hate, nor the homoeomeriÆ of Anaxagoras. He also denied that the primary elements had any sensible qualities whatever. He conceived of all things as being composed of invisible, intangible, and indivisible particles or atoms, which, by reason of variation in their configuration, combination, or position, give rise to the varieties of forms: to the atom he imputed self-existence and eternal duration. His doctrine, therefore, explains how it is that the many can arise from the one, and in this particular he reconciled Destiny, Fate and resistless law. the apparent contradictions of the Ionians and Eleatics. The theory of chemistry, as it now exists, essentially includes his views. The general formative principle of Nature he regarded as being Destiny or Fate; but there are indications that by this he meant nothing more than irreversible law.

A system thus based upon severe mathematical considerations, and taking as its starting-point a vacuum and atoms—the former actionless and passionless; which considers the production of new things as only new aggregations, and the decay of the old as separations; which recognizes in compound bodies specific arrangements of atoms to one another; which can rise to the conception that even a single atom may constitute a world—such a system may commend itself to our attention for its results, but surely not to our approval, when we find it carrying us to the conclusions that even Is led to atheism. mathematical cognition is a mere semblance; that the soul is only a finely-constituted form fitted into the grosser bodily frame; that even for reason itself there is an absolute impossibility of all certainty; that scepticism is to be indulged in to that degree that we may doubt whether, when a cone has been cut asunder, its two surfaces are alike; that the final result of human inquiry is the absolute demonstration that man is incapable of knowledge; that, even if the truth be in his possession, he can never be certain of it; that the world is an illusive phantasm, and that there is no God.

Legends of Democritus.

I need scarcely refer to the legendary stories related of Democritus, as that he put out his eyes with a burning-glass that he might no longer be deluded with their false indications, and more tranquilly exercise his reason—a fiction bearing upon its face the contemptuous accusation of his antagonists, but, by the stolidity of subsequent ages, received as an actual fact instead of a sarcasm. As to his habit of so constantly deriding the knowledge and follies of men that he universally acquired the epithet of the laughing philosopher, we may receive the opinion of the great physician Hippocrates, who being requested by the people of Abdera to cure him of his madness, after long discoursing with him, expressed himself penetrated with admiration, and even with the most profound veneration for him, and rebuked those who had sent him with the remark that they themselves were the more distempered of the two.

Thus far European Greece had done but little in the cause of philosophy. The chief schools were in Asia Minor, or among the Greek colonies of Italy. But the time had now arrived when the mother country was to Rise of philosophy in European Greece. enter upon a distinguished career, though, it must be confessed, from a most unfavourable beginning. This was by no means the only occasion on which the intellectual activity of the Greek colonies made itself felt in the destinies of Europe. The mercantile character in a community has ever been found conducive to mental activity and physical adventure; it holds in light esteem prescriptive opinion, and puts things at the actual value they at the time possess. If the Greek colonies thus discharged the important function of introducing and disseminating speculative philosophy, we shall find them again, five hundred years later, occupied with a similar task on the advent of that period in which philosophical speculation was about to be supplanted by religious faith. For there Commercial communities favourable to new ideas. can be no doubt that, humanly speaking, the cause of the rapid propagation of Christianity, in its first ages, lay in the extraordinary facilities existing among the commercial communities scattered all around the shores of the Mediterranean Sea, from the ports of the Levant to those of France and Spain. An incessant intercourse was kept up among them during the five centuries before Christ; it became, under Roman influence, more and more active, and of increasing political importance. Such a state of things is in the highest degree conducive to the propagation of thought, and, indeed, to its origination, through the constant excitement it furnishes to intellectual activity. Commercial communities, in this respect, present a striking contrast to agricultural. By their aid speculative philosophy was rapidly disseminated everywhere, as was subsequently Christianity. But the agriculturists steadfastly adhered with marvellous stolidity to their ancestral traditions and polytheistic absurdities, until the very designation—paganism—under which their system passes was given as a nickname derived from themselves.

Philosophical influence of the Greek colonies.

The intellectual condition of the Greek colonies of Italy and Sicily has not attracted the attention of critics in the manner it deserves. For, though its political result may appear to those whose attention is fixed by mere material aggrandizement to have been totally eclipsed by the subsequent power of the Roman republic, to one who looks at things in a mere general way it may be a probable inquiry whether the philosophy cultivated in those towns has not, in the course of ages, produced as solid and lasting results as the military achievements of the Eternal City. The relations of the Italian peninsula to the career of European civilization are to be classified under three epochs, the first corresponding to the philosophy generated in the southern Greek towns: this would have attained the elevation long before reached in the advanced systems of India had it not been prevented by the rapid development of Roman power; the second presents the military influence of republican and imperial Rome; to the third belongs the agency of ecclesiastical Rome—for the production of the last we shall find hereafter that the preceding two conspire. The Italian effect upon the whole has therefore been philosophical, material, and mixed. We are greatly in want of a history of the first, for which doubtless many facts still remain to a painstaking and enlightened inquirer.

Origin of the Greek colonial system.

It was on account of her small territory and her numerous population that Greece was obliged to colonize. To these motives must be added internal dissensions, and particularly the consequences of unequal marriages. So numerous did these colonies and their offshoots become, that a great Greek influence pervaded all the Mediterranean shores and many of the most important islands, attention more particularly being paid to the latter, from their supposed strategical value; thus, in the opinion of Alexander the Great, the command of the Mediterranean lay in the possession of Cyprus. The Greek colonists were filibusters; they seized by force the women wherever they settled, but their children were taught to speak the paternal language, as has been the case in more recent times with the descendants of the Spaniards in America. The wealth of some of these Greek colonial towns is said to have been incredible. Crotona was more than twelve miles in circumference; and Sybaris, another of the Italiot cities, was so luxurious and dissipated as even to give rise to a proverb. The prosperity of these places was due to two causes: they were not only the centres of great agricultural districts, but carried on also an active commerce in all directions, the dense population of the mother country offering them a steady and profitable market; they also maintained an active traffic with all the Mediterranean cities; thus, if they furnished Athens with corn, they also furnished Carthage with oil. In the Greek cities connected with this colonial system, especially in Athens, the business of ship-building and navigation was so extensively prosecuted as to give a special character to public life. In other parts of Greece, as in Sparta, it was altogether different. In that state the laws of Lycurgus had abolished private property; all things were held in common; savage life was reduced to a system, and therefore there was no object in commerce. But in Athens, commerce was regarded as being so far from dishonourable that some of the most illustrious men, whose names have descended to us as philosophers, were occupied with mercantile pursuits. Aristotle kept a druggist's shop in Athens, and Plato sold oil in Egypt.

It was the intention of Athens, had she succeeded in the conquest of Sicily, to make an attempt upon Carthage, foreseeing therein the dominion of the Mediterranean, as was actually realized subsequently by Rome. The destruction of that city constituted the point of ascendancy in the history of the Great Republic. Carthage stood upon a peninsula forty-five miles round, with a neck only three miles across. Her territory has been estimated as having a sea-line of not less than 1400 miles, and containing 300 towns; she had also possessions in Spain, in Sicily, and other Mediterranean islands, acquired, not by conquest, but by colonization. In the silver mines of Spain she employed not less than forty thousand men. In these respects she was guided by the maxims of her Phoenician ancestry, for the Tyrians had colonized for depÔts, and had forty stations of that kind in the Mediterranean. Indeed, Carthage herself originated in that way, owing her development to the position she held at the junction of the east and west basins. The Carthaginian merchants did not carry for hire, but dealt in their Carthaginian supremacy in the Mediterranean. commodities. This implied an extensive system of depÔts and bonding. They had anticipated many of the devices of modern commerce. They effected insurances, made loans on bottomry, and it has been supposed that their leathern money may have been of the nature of our bank notes.

Attempts of the Persians at dominion in the Mediterranean.

In the preceding chapter we have spoken of the attempts of the Asiatics on Egypt and the south shore of the Mediterranean; we have now to turn to their operations on the north shore, the consequences of which are of the utmost interest in the history of philosophy. It appears that the cities of Asia Minor, after their contest with the Lydian kings, had fallen an easy prey to the Persian power. It remained, therefore, only for that power to pass to the European continent. A pretext is easily found where the policy is so clear. So far as the internal condition of Greece was concerned, nothing could be more tempting to an invader. There seemed to be no bond of union between the different towns, and, indeed, the more prominent ones Contest between them and the Greeks. might be regarded as in a state of chronic revolution. In Athens, since B.C. 622, the laws of Draco had been supplanted by those of Solon; and again and again the government had been seized by violence or gained through intrigue by one adventurer after another. Under these circumstances the Persian king passed an army into Europe. The military events of both this and the succeeding invasion under Xerxes have been more than sufficiently illustrated by the brilliant imagination of the lively Greeks. It was needless, however, to devise such fictions as the million of men who crossed into Europe, or the two hundred thousand who lay dead upon the field after the battle of PlatÆa. If there The fifty years' war, and eventual supremacy of Athens. were not such stubborn facts as the capture and burning of Athens, the circumstance that these wars lasted for fifty years would be sufficient to inform us that all the advantages were not on one side. Wars do not last so long without bringing upon both parties disasters as well as conferring glories; and had these been as exterminating and over whelming as classical authors have supposed, our surprise may well be excited that the Persian annals have preserved so little memory of them. Greece did not perceive that, if posterity must take her accounts as true, it must give the palm of glory to Persia, who could, with unfaltering perseverance, persist in attacks illustrated by such unparalleled catastrophes. She did not perceive that the annals of a nation may be more splendid from their exhibiting a courage which could bear up for half a century against continual disasters, and extract victory at last from defeat.

In pursuance of their policy, the Persians extended their dominion to Cyrene and Barca on the south, as well as to Thrace and Macedonia on the north. The Persian wars gave rise to that wonderful development in Greek art which has so worthily excited the admiration of subsequent ages. The assertion is quite true that after those wars the Greeks could form in sculpture living men. On the part of the Persians, these military undertakings were not of the base kind so common in antiquity; they were the carrying out of a policy conceived with great ability, their object being to obtain countries for tribute and not for devastation. The great critic Niebuhr, by whose opinions I am guided in the views I express of these events, admits that the Greek accounts, when examined, present little that was possible. The Persian empire does not seem to have suffered at all; and Plato, whose opinion must be considered as of very great authority, says that, on the whole, the Persian wars reflect extremely little honour on the Greeks. It was asserted that only thirty-one towns, and most of them small ones, were faithful to Greece. Treason to her seems for years in succession to have infected all her ablest men. It was not Pausanias alone who wanted to be king under the supremacy of Persia. Such a satrap would have borne about the same relation to the great king as the modern pacha does to the grand seignior. However, we must do justice to those able men. A king was what Greece in reality required; had she secured one at this time strong enough to hold her conflicting interests in check, she would have become the mistress of the world. Her leading men saw this.

The consequence is her vast intellectual progress.

The elevating effect of the Persian wars was chiefly felt in Athens. It was there that the grand development of pure art, literature, and science took place. As to Sparta, she remained barbarous as she had ever been; the Spartans continuing robbers and impostors, in their national life exhibiting not a single feature that can be commended. Mechanical art reached its perfection at Corinth; real art at Athens, finding a multitude not only of true, but also of new expressions. Before Pericles the only style of architecture was the Doric; his became at once the age of perfect Her progress in art. beauty. It also became the age of freedom in thinking and departure from the national faith. In this respect the history of Pericles and of Aspasia is very significant. His, also, was the great age of oratory, but of oratory leading to delusion, the democratical forms of Athens being altogether deceptive, power ever remaining in the hands of a few leading men, who did everything. The true popular sentiment, as was almost always the case under those ancient republican institutions, could find for itself no means of expression. The great men were only too prone to regard their fellow-citizens as a rabble, mere things to be played off against one another, and to consider that the objects of life are dominion and lust, that love, self-sacrifice, and devotion are fictions; that oaths are only good for deception.

The treaty with Persia.

Though the standard of statesmanship, at the period of the Persian wars, was very low, there can be no doubt that among the Greek leaders were those who clearly understood the causes of the Asiatic attack; and hence, with an instinct of self-preservation, defensive alliances were continually maintained with Egypt. When their valour and endurance had given to the Greeks a glorious issue to the war, the articles contained in the final treaty manifest clearly the motives and understandings of both parties. No Persian vessel was to appear between the Cyanean Rocks and Chelidonian Islands; no Persian army to approach within three days' journey of the Mediterranean Sea, B.C. 449.

To Athens herself the war had given political supremacy. We need only look at her condition fifty years after the battle of PlatÆa. She was mistress of more than a thousand miles of the coast of Asia Minor; she held as dependencies more than forty islands; she controlled the straits between Europe and Asia; her fleets ranged the Mediterranean and the Black Seas; she had monopolized the trade of all the adjoining countries; her magazines were full of the most valuable objects of commerce. From the ashes of the Persian fire she had risen up so supremely beautiful that her temples, her statues, her works of art, in She becomes the centre of policy and philosophy. their exquisite perfection, have since had no parallel in the world. Her intellectual supremacy equalled her political. To her, as to a focal point, the rays of light from every direction converged. The philosophers of Italy and Asia Minor directed their steps to her as to the acknowledged centre of mental activity. As to Egypt, an utter ruin had befallen her since she was desolated by the Persian arms. Yet we must not therefore infer that though, as conquerors, the Persians had trodden out the most aged civilization on the globe, as sovereigns they were haters of knowledge, or merciless as kings. We must not forget that the Greeks of Asia Minor were satisfied with their rule, or, at all events, preferred rather to remain their subjects than to contract any permanent political connexions with the conquering Greeks of Europe.

In this condition of political glory, Athens became not only the birthplace of new and beautiful productions of art, founded on a more just appreciation of the true than had yet been attained to in any previous age of the world (which, it may be added, have never been surpassed, if, indeed, they have been equalled since), she also became the receptacle for every philosophical opinion, new and old. Ionian, Italian, Egyptian, Persian, all were brought to her, and contrasted and compared together. Indeed, the philosophical celebrity of Greece is altogether due to Athens. The rest of the country participated but little in the cultivation of learning. It is a popular error that Greece, in the aggregate, was a learned country.

We have already seen how the researches of individual inquirers, passing from point to point, had conducted them, in many instances, to a suspicion of the futility of human knowledge; and looking at the results reached by the successive philosophical schools, we cannot fail to remark that there was a general tendency to scepticism. We have seen how, from the material and tangible beginnings of the Ionians, the Eleatics land us not only in a blank atheism, but in a disbelief of the existence of the world. And though it may be said that these were only the isolated results of special schools, it is not to be forgotten that they were of schools the most advanced. The time had now arrived when the name of a master was no more to usurp the place of reason, as had been hitherto the case; when these last results of the different methods of philosophizing were to be brought together, a criticism of a higher order established, and conclusions of a higher order deduced.

Commencement of the higher analysis.

Thus it will ever be with all human investigation. The primitive philosophical elements from which we start are examined, first by one and then by another, each drawing his own special conclusions and deductions, and each firmly believing in the truth of his inferences. Each analyst has seen the whole subject from a particular point of view, without concerning himself with the discordances, contradictions, and incompatibilities obvious enough when his conclusions come to be compared with those of other analysts as skilful as himself. In process of time, it needs must be that a new school of examiners will arise, who, taking the results at which their predecessors have arrived from an examination of the primary elements, will institute a secondary comparison; a comparison of results with results; a comparison of a higher order, and more likely to lead to absolute truth.

Illustration from subsequent Roman history.

Perhaps I cannot better convey what I here mean by this secondary and higher analysis of philosophical questions than by introducing, as an illustration, what took place subsequently in Rome, through her policy of universal religious toleration. The priests and followers of every god and of every faith were permitted to pursue without molestation their special forms of worship. Of these, it may be supposed that nearly all were perfectly sincere in their adherence to their special divinity, and, if the occasion had arisen, could have furnished unanswerable arguments in behalf of his supremacy and of the truth of his doctrines. Yet it is very clear that, by thus bringing these several primary systems into contact, a comparison of a secondary and of a higher order, and therefore far more likely to approach to absolute truth, must needs be established among them. It is very well known that the popular result of this secondary examination was the philosophical rejection of polytheism.

The Sophists.

So, in Athens the result of the secondary examination of philosophical systems and deductions was scepticism as regards them all, and the rise of a new order of men—the Sophists—who not only rejected the validity of all former philosophical methods, but carried their infidelity to a degree plainly not warranted by the facts of the case, in this, that they not only denied that human reason had thus far succeeded in ascertaining anything, but even affirmed that it is incapable, from its very nature, as dependent on human organization, or the condition under which it acts, of determining the truth at all; nay, that even if the truth is actually in its possession, since it has no criterion by which to recognize it, it cannot so much as be certain that it is in such possession of it. From these principles it follows that, since we have no standard of the true, neither can we have any standard of the good, and that our ideas of what is good and what is evil are altogether produced by education or by convention. Or, to use the phrase adopted by the Sophists, "it is might that makes right." Right and wrong are hence seen to be mere fictions created by society, having no eternal or absolute existence in nature. The will of a monarch, or of a majority in a community, declares what the law shall be; the law defines what is right and what is wrong; and these, therefore, instead of having an actual existence, are mere illusions, owing their birth to the exercise of force. It is might that has determined and defined what is right. They reject philosophy, and even morality. And hence it follows that it is needless for a man to trouble himself with the monitions of conscience, or to be troubled thereby, for conscience, instead of being anything real, is an imaginary fiction, or, at the best, owes its origin to education, and is the creation of our social state. Hence the wise will give himself no concern as to a meritorious act or a crime, seeing that the one is intrinsically neither better nor worse than the other; but he will give himself sedulous concern as respects his outer or external relations—his position in society; conforming his acts to that standard which it in its wisdom or folly, but in the exercise of its might, has declared shall be regarded as right. Or, if his occasions be such as to make it for his interest to depart from the social rule, let him do it in secrecy; or, what is far better, let him cultivate rhetoric, that noble art by which the wrong may be made to appear the right; by which he who has committed a crime may so mystify society as to delude it into the belief that he is worthy of praise; and by which he may prove that his enemy, who has really performed some meritorious deed, has been guilty of a crime. Animated by such considerations, the Sophists passed from place to place, offering to sell for a sum of money a knowledge of the rhetorical art, and disposed of their services in the instruction of the youth of wealthy and noble families.

What shall we say of such a system and of such a state of things? Simply this: that it indicated a complete mental and social demoralization—mental demoralization, for the principles of knowledge were sapped, and man persuaded that his reason was no guide; social demoralization, for he was taught that right and wrong, virtue and vice, conscience, and law, and God, are imaginary fictions; that there is no harm in the commission of sin, though there may be harm, as assuredly there is folly, in being detected therein; that it is excellent for a man to sell his country to the Persian king, provided that the sum of money he receives is large enough, and that the transaction is so darkly conducted that the public, and particularly his enemies, can never find it out. Let him never forget that patriotism is the first delusion of a simpleton, and the last refuge of a knave.

Such were the results of the first attempt to correct the partial philosophies, by submitting them to the measure of a more universal one; such the manner in which, instead of only losing their exclusiveness and imperfections by their contact with one another, they were wrested from their proper object, and made subservient to the purpose of deception. Nor was it science alone that was affected; already might be discerned the foreshadowings of that They reject the national religion. conviction which many centuries later occasioned the final destruction of polytheism in Rome. Already, in Athens, the voice of philosophers was heard, that among so many gods and so many different worships it was impossible for a man to ascertain what is true. Already, many even of the educated were overwhelmed with the ominous suggestion that, if ever it had been the will of heaven to reveal any form of faith to the world, such a revelation, considering its origin, must necessarily have come with sufficient power to override all opposition; that if there existed only as many as two forms of faith synchronous and successful in the world, that fact would of itself demonstrate that neither of them is true, and that there never had been any revelation from an all-wise and omnipotent God. Nor was it merely among the speculative men that these infidelities were cherished; the leading politicians and statesmen had become deeply infected with them. It was not Anaxagoras alone who was convicted of atheism; the same charge was made against Pericles, the head of the republic—he who Spread of their opinions among the highest classes. had done so much for the glory of Athens—the man who, in practical life, was, beyond all question, the first of his age. With difficulty he succeeded, by the use of what influence remained to him, in saving the life of the guilty philosopher his friend, but in the public estimation he was universally viewed as a participator in his crime. If the foundations of philosophy and those of religion were thus sapped, the foundations of law experienced no better fate. The Sophists, who were wandering all over the world, saw that each nation had its own ideas of merit and demerit, and therefore its own system of law; that even in different towns there were contrary conceptions of right and wrong, and therefore opposing codes. It is evident that in such examinations they applied the same principles which had guided them in their analysis of philosophy and religion, and that the result could be no other than it was, to bring them to the conclusion that there is nothing absolute in justice or in law. To what an appalling condition society has arrived, when it reaches the positive conclusion that there is no truth, no religion, no justice, no virtue in the world; that the only object of human exertion is unrestrained physical enjoyment; the only standard of a man's position, wealth; that, since there is no possibility of truth, whose eternal principles might serve for an uncontrovertible and common guide, we should resort to deception and the arts of persuasion, that we may dupe others for our purposes; that there is no sin in undermining the social contract; no crime in blasphemy, or rather there is no blasphemy at all, since there are no gods; that "man is the measure of all things," as Protagoras teaches, and that "he is the criterion of existence;" that "thought is only the relation of the thinking subject to the object thought of, and that They end in blank atheism. the thinking subject, the soul, is nothing more than the sum of the different moments of thinking." It is no wonder that that Sophist who was the author of such doctrines should be condemned to death to satisfy the clamours of a populace who had not advanced sufficiently into the depths of this secondary, this higher philosophy, and that it was only by flight that he could save himself from the punishment awaiting the opening sentiment of his book: "Of the gods I cannot tell whether they are or not, for much hinders us from knowing this—both the obscurity of the subject and the shortness of life." It is no wonder that the social demoralization spread apace, when men like Gorgias, the disciple of Empedocles, were to be found, who laughed at virtue, made an open derision of morality, and proved, by metaphysical demonstration, that nothing at all exists.

From these statements respecting the crisis at which ancient philosophy had arrived, we might be disposed to believe that the result was unmitigated evil, for it scarcely deserves mention that the quibbles and disputes of the Sophists occasioned an extraordinary improvement of the Greek language, introducing precision into its terms, and a wonderful dialectical skill into its use. For us there may be extracted from these melancholy conclusions at least one instructive lesson—that it is not during the process of decomposition of philosophies, and especially of religions, Political dangers of the higher analysis. that social changes occur, for such breakings-up commonly go on in an isolated, and therefore innocuous way; but if by chance the fragments and decomposed portions are brought together, and attempts are made by fusion to incorporate them anew, or to extract from them, by a secondary analysis, what truth they contain, a crisis is at once brought on, and—such is the course of events—in the catastrophe that ensues Illustrations from the Middle Ages. they are commonly all absolutely destroyed. It was doubtless their foresight of such consequences that inspired the Italian statesmen of the Middle Ages with a resolute purpose of crushing in the bud every encroachment on ecclesiastical authority, and every attempt at individual interpretation of religious doctrines. For it is not to be supposed that men of clear intellect should be insensible to the obvious unreasonableness of many of the dogmas that had been consecrated by authority. But if once permission were accorded to human criticism and human interpretation, what other issue could there be than that doctrine upon doctrine, and sect upon sect should arise; that theological principles should undergo a total decomposition, until two men could scarcely be found whose views coincided; nay, even more than that, that the same man should change his opinion with the changing incidents of the different periods of his life. No matter what might be the plausible guise of the beginning, and the ostensibly cogent arguments for its necessity, once let the decomposition commence, and no human power could arrest it until it had become thorough and complete. Considering the prestige, the authority, and the mass of fact to be dealt with, it might take many centuries for this process to be finished, but that that result would at length be accomplished no enlightened man could doubt. The experience of the ancient European world had shown that in the act of such decompositions there is but little danger, since, for the time being, each sect, and, indeed, each individual, has a guiding rule of life. But as soon as the period of secondary analysis is reached a crisis must inevitably ensue, in all probability involving not only religion, but also the social contract. And though, by the exercise of force on the part of the interests that are disturbed, Danger of intellect outgrowing formulas of faith. aided by that popular sentiment which is abhorrent of anarchy, the crisis might, for a time, be put off, it could not be otherwise than that Europe should be left in that deplorable state which must result when the intellect of a people has outgrown its formulas of faith. A fearful condition to contemplate, for such a dislocation must also affect political relations, and necessarily implies revolt against existing law. Nations plunged in the abyss of irreligion must necessarily be nations in anarchy. For a time their tendency to explosion may be kept down by the firm application of the hand of power; but this is simply an antagonism, it is no cure. The social putrefaction proceeds, working its way downward into classes that are lower and lower, until at length it involves the institutions that are relied on for its arrest. Armies, the machinery of compression, once infected, the end is at hand, but no human Absolute necessity of preparing communities for these changes. foresight can predict what the event shall be, especially if the contemporaneous ruling powers have either ignorantly or wilfully neglected to prepare society for the inevitable trial it is about to undergo. It is the most solemn of all the duties of governments, when once they have become aware of such a momentous condition, to prepare the nations for its fearful consequences. For this it may, perhaps, be lawful for them to dissemble in a temporary manner, as it is sometimes proper for a physician to dissemble with his patient; it may be lawful for them even to resort to the use of force, but never should such measures of doubtful correctness be adopted without others directed to a preparation of the mass of society for the trials through which it is about to pass. Such, doubtless, were the profound views of the great Italian statesmen of the Middle Ages; such, doubtless, were the arguments by which they justified to themselves resistance against the beginning of the evil—a course for which Europe has too often and unfairly condemned them.

Summary of the preceding theories.

It remains for us now to review the details presented in the foregoing pages for the purpose of determining the successive phases of development through which the Greek mind passed. It is not with the truth or fallacy of these details that we have to do, but with their order of occurrence. They are points enabling us to describe graphically the curve of Grecian intellectual advance.

The starting point of Greek philosophy is physical and geocentral. The earth is the grand object of the universe, and, as the necessary result, erroneous ideas are entertained as to the relations and dimensions of the sea and air. This philosophy was hardly a century old before it began to cosmogonize, using the principles it considered itself sure of. Long before it was able to get rid of local ideas, such as upward and downward in space, it undertook to explain the origin of the world.

But, as advances were made, it was recognized that creation, in its various parts, displays intention and design, the adaptation of means to secure proposed ends. This suggested a reasoning and voluntary agency, like that of man, in the government of the world; and from a continual reference to human habits and acts, Greek philosophy passed through its stage of anthropoid conceptions.

A little farther progress awakened suspicions that the mind of man can obtain no certain knowledge; and the opinion at last prevailed that we have no trustworthy criterion of truth. In the scepticism thus setting in, the approach to Oriental ideas is each successive instant more and more distinct.

Approach to Oriental ideas.

This period of doubt was the immediate forerunner of more correct cosmical opinions. The heliocentric mechanism of the planetary system was introduced, the earth deposed to a subordinate position. The doctrines, both physical and intellectual, founded on geocentric ideas, were necessarily endangered, and, since these had connected themselves with the prevailing religious views, and were represented by important material interests, the public began to practise persecution and the philosophers hypocrisy. Pantheistic notions of the nature of the world became more distinct, and, as their necessary consequence, the doctrines of Emanation, Transmigration, and Absorption were entertained. From this it is but a step to the suspicion that matter, motion, and time are phantasms of the imagination—opinions embodied in the atomic theory, which asserts that atoms and space alone exist; and which became more refined when it recognized that atoms are only mathematical points; and still more so when it considered them as mere centres of force. The brink of Buddhism was here approached.

As must necessarily ever be the case where men are coexisting in different psychical stages of advance, some having made a less, some a greater intellectual progress, all these views which we have described successively, were at last contemporaneously entertained. At this point commenced the action of the Sophists, who, by setting the doctrines of one school in opposition to those of another, and representing them all as of equal value, occasioned the destruction of them all, and the philosophy founded on physical speculation came to an end.

Uniformity in the manner of intellectual progress.

Of this phase of Greek intellectual life, if we compare the beginning with the close, we cannot fail to observe how great is the improvement. The thoughts dealt with at the later period are intrinsically of a higher order than those at the outset. From the puerilities and errors with which we have thus been occupied, we learn that there is a definite mode of progress for the mind of man; from the history of later times we shall find that it is ever in the same direction.
